1. Awọn Ilana Aabo pataki

Read all instructions carefully before using the appliance. Failure to follow these instructions may result in electric shock, fire, and/or serious injury.

  • Aabo ti ara ẹni: Always wear app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) such as safety glasses, sturdy footwear, and hearing protection. Do not operate the mower barefoot or in open-toed sandals.
  • Aabo Itanna: Ensure the power supply matches the specifications on the product label. Use only extension cords suitable for outdoor use and rated for the mower's power consumption. Keep the power cord away from the cutting blade.
  • Aabo Agbegbe Iṣẹ: Keep children, pets, and bystanders away from the mowing area. Clear the area of stones, sticks, wires, and other debris before starting the mower.
  • Isẹ: Never operate the mower in wet grass or rain. Always push the mower forward, never pull it towards you. Do not lift or carry the mower while the motor is running.
  • Itọju: Disconnect the mower from the power supply before cleaning, adjusting, or performing any maintenance. Regularly inspect the blade for damage and ensure all fasteners are tight.

3. Apejọ Awọn ilana

Your lawn mower requires minimal assembly. Follow these steps to prepare your mower for use.

  1. So Ọpá Ìmúlémọ́lé náà mọ́:

    Unfold the handlebar and secure it to the main unit using the provided knobs and bolts. Ensure it clicks firmly into place.

4. Awọn ilana Iṣiṣẹ

4.1. Ṣaaju Bibẹrẹ

  • Inspect the lawn for any objects that could be thrown by the blade.
  • Ensure the grass collector is correctly installed.
  • Check that the blade is securely fastened and not damaged.

4.2. Siṣàtúnṣe Ige Gige

The Lehmann ECO 2000W offers 3 cutting height levels (e.g., 20mm, 38mm, 56mm). Adjust the cutting height using the lever located on the side of the mower.

4.3. Bibẹrẹ Mower

  1. Plug the mower into a suitable outdoor power outlet.
  2. Press and hold the safety button on the handlebar.
  3. While holding the safety button, pull the operating lever towards the handlebar. The motor will start.
  4. Release the safety button, but continue to hold the operating lever to keep the mower running.

4.4. Ọ̀nà Ìgé Gígé

  • Mow in overlapping strips to ensure even coverage.
  • Avoid overloading the motor by not attempting to cut excessively long or wet grass in a single pass.
  • Regularly check the grass collector and empty it when full to maintain optimal performance.

5. Itọju

Regular maintenance ensures the longevity and efficient operation of your lawn mower. Always disconnect the power supply before performing any maintenance.

5.1. Ninu

  • After each use, clean the underside of the mower deck and the grass collector.
  • Use a brush or scraper to remove grass clippings. Do not use water directly on the motor housing.

5.2. Abojuto abẹfẹlẹ

  • Inspect the blade regularly for sharpness and damage. A dull or damaged blade can affect cutting performance and motor efficiency.
  • If necessary, have the blade sharpened or replaced by a qualified service technician.

5.3. Ibi ipamọ

  • Mọ mower daradara ṣaaju ki o to fipamọ.
  • Fold the handlebar to save space.
  • Store the mower in a dry, secure location, out of reach of children.

6. Laasigbotitusita

IsoroOwun to le FaOjutu
Mower ko bẹrẹNo power supply; Safety switch not engaged; Overload protection activated.Check power connection; Ensure safety button and operating lever are pressed correctly; Allow motor to cool down.
Ige iṣẹ ti ko daraDull or damaged blade; Grass collector full; Cutting height too low for grass condition.Sharpen or replace blade; Empty grass collector; Increase cutting height.
Gbigbọn ti o pọjuDamaged or unbalanced blade; Loose fasteners.Inspect blade for damage and replace if necessary; Tighten all screws and bolts.
